The Fiat Strada Turbo 2024 Arrives in the Brazilian Market Bringing Significant News and a Limited Edition That Promises to Be the Highlight of the Line. In This Comparison, We Explore the Features and Differences Between the Ranch and Ultra Versions, as Well as Present the Exclusive Edizione 25.
The FIAT Strada Ranch bets on a design that combines rustic and sophisticated elements. Comparisons with rural settings are inevitable, evidenced by details like mirrors in the color of the car and chrome adornments. On the other hand, the Ultra offers a more urban and modern look, with mirrors painted gray and dark-finished bumpers that stand out, accompanied by LED headlights and Mopar steps. The Ultra’s 16-inch wheels have a dark finish, contrasting with the Ranch’s diamond-finished wheels.
The Ranch interior features brown leather finishes, creating an elegant and cozy environment. Brown details on the dashboard and doors complement the style. Now the Fiat Strada Ultra presents an interior with gray and red accents, creating a sportier atmosphere. The interior finish follows the same line, highlighted by red stitching on the seats and steering wheel.
Edizione 25: Tribute to 25 Years of the Strada
The Edizione 25 is a limited edition of 1,025 units released to celebrate the 25th anniversary of the Strada model. Based on the Ultra version, this special edition features unique characteristics:

- Exclusive Color: Sting Gray, giving a distinctive and elegant look.
- Exterior Details: Wheels with a dark finish and commemorative “25” stickers on the fenders.
- Customized Interior: Seats and dashboard with inscriptions referring to the 25 years of the model.
Prices and Considerations
The Ranch and Ultra versions are similarly priced, starting at approximately R$ 132,990, while the Edizione 25 has a slightly higher price, around R$ 135,990. These prices position the Fiat Strada Turbo 2024 as a competitive option in the compact pickup segment.
The choice between the Ranch and Ultra versions of the Fiat Strada Turbo 2024 will depend on the buyers’ personal preferences in terms of style and functionality. The limited edition Edizione 25, on the other hand, is an option for those seeking exclusivity and a tribute to the successful trajectory of the Strada.
